How can I send and how will I receive documents? How do I know if they have been received?

Documents can be sent by:

  • Attaching them to our quote form.
  • E-mail (as an attached document).
  • Fax: +44 (0) 114 207 0292.
  • Regular post.
  • Courier service.

We always reply to all messages sent to us and acknowledge receipt of all materials received.

If you do not hear from us within 24 hours after having sent your message and documents (if sent by fax, e-mail or through our quote form) or after a reasonable time has elapsed (if you have used the post or a courier service), please contact us again. It probably means that we have not received them.
